Nestled in the heart of West Yorkshire, Huddersfield Train Station serves as a vibrant connective hub for travelers journeying across the United Kingdom. A bustling station that seamlessly blends historical charm with modern amenities, Huddersfield offers a range of services ensuring a pleasant and smooth travel experience.
The station boasts comprehensive facilities to cater to every traveler’s needs. The ticket office operates from 5:45 AM to 8:00 PM Monday through Saturday and 7:45 AM to 8:00 PM on Sundays. For those who book tickets online, collection is a breeze with easily accessible ticket machines, and there's dedicated support for smartcard users as well.
Accessibility is a priority with step-free access throughout the station, alongside accessible ticket machines and well-equipped waiting areas. Although there's no luggage storage, heated waiting rooms are available on several platforms. But worry not if you need assistance—station staff are on hand to offer help and ensure your journey runs without a hitch.
Huddersfield station is strategically situated to link you with several transport options. Rail replacement services can be accessed outside the station, ensuring continuity of travel in case of any disruptions. Additionally, a taxi rank conveniently located just outside offers easy access for onward journeys. Whether catching a connecting bus (with printable journey information available here) or continuing your journey by rail, you'll find Huddersfield's transport connections straightforward and flexible.

Merthyr Vale train station, nestled in the charming valleys of South Wales, serves as a gateway to an array of picturesque Welsh towns and vibrant city destinations. While it's a modest station in terms of size, Merthyr Vale offers passengers a unique glimpse into both the tranquil natural beauty that the region is known for and the bustling cultural hubs within easy reach. Whether you're planning a scenic journey or simply commuting, the station meets your travel needs with efficiency and functionality.
Though the station lacks a ticket office, fear not; ticket machines are readily available for purchasing and collecting tickets, ensuring a seamless experience as you embark on your journey. The station is equipped with accessible ticket machines and an induction loop, enhancing the experience for passengers with specific needs. However, amenities such as waiting rooms, toilets, and refreshment facilities are unfortunately absent. For assistance or inquiries, you’ll find helpful information points complemented by CCTV surveillance for safety.
Merthyr Vale’s connectivity doesn't end with trains. There's a rail replacement bus service that provides additional travel options, located conveniently at Gray's Place close to the station entrance. Currently, the station does not support accessible taxi services or parking facilities, which prospective passengers may want to consider when planning their visit.
